Michelle Schuberg joins The Pulse as general manager

Specialist agency The Pulse has appointed Michelle Schuberg as its general manager.

The announcement:

Specialist agency, The Pulse, has announced the appointment of Michelle Schuberg to General Manager.

With offices in Sydney and Hong Kong, The Pulse works across the corporate, education and health sectors. The agency specialises is using emerging technologies to deliver cutting edge learning and entertainment, with a particular focus on the application of VR and AR.

Schuberg comes to The Pulse from global integrated agency, Imagination. Having held Executive Creative Director roles at a number of global creative agencies over the past decade, Michelle has led large teams, both locally and internationally to deliver successful campaigns for some of the worlds biggest brands.

“What has always driven me while working in marketing and communications, is the opportunity to challenge the status quo around how people receive and retain information,” said Schuberg.

Schuberg will spearhead new projects on the ‘Pulse IQ’ platform, one of the world’s first collaborative VR platforms for education and training, which recently received over $1 million in matched funding from the federal government’s Accelerating Commercialisation Grant.

Brett Heil, Founder of The Pulse, said, “Many agencies in this space are technology-led, often missing the strategy and instructional design needed to deliver effective outcomes. At the same time, there are creative agencies and consultancies who have all the strategy and thinking buttoned down, but may not understand the nuances of the technologies well enough to leverage them.

“We are excited by Michelle’s ability to integrate the best of both worlds to deliver our capabilities in the most effective way possible for our clients. I have high expectations for the next stage of our growth under Michelle’s guidance.”

Schuberg is thrilled to combine her expertise in effective and innovative storytelling with her passion for true collaboration, to help clients deliver ground breaking work across corporate, education and health industries.

“I came to The Pulse to be part of a team of people who are really pushing the boundary with immersive technology, because I believe it can revolutionise how we communicate with our audiences. If used well and deployed properly, immersive technology can have such an impact on so many people. I want to be a part of that journey and part of the group of people around the world that look to pioneer how those emerging technologies are best used,” she said.
